Biography

Anna Balykina (maiden surname: Prilepskaya) graduated from the General Medicine program at Saint Petersburg State University (GPA=4.75 out of 5; diploma magna cum laude). Anna currently holds a Degree: Medical Doctor (BSc & MSc equivalent, 360 ECTS credits). Anna's former position was a laboratory technician and grant executor at the Laboratory of Cellular Mechanisms of Blood Homeostasis in the Sechenov Institute of Evolutionary Physiology and Biochemistry in Saint Petersburg. Anna's work included investigation of molecular mechanisms of therapeutical agents, assessment of signaling pathways activation, reactive oxide species formation, apoptosis induction, and changes in cell viability.
